What state has the highest point Sassafras Mt.?

Final answer:

Sassafras Mountain is the highest point in South Carolina, standing at 3,554 feet above sea level and being a part of the Blue Ridge Mountains.

Step-by-step explanation:

The state with the highest point named Sassafras Mountain is South Carolina. Sassafras Mountain is the tallest mountain in the state and is part of the Blue Ridge Mountains, a range in the Appalachian Mountains system.

The peak reaches an elevation of 3,554 feet (1,083 meters) above sea level, making it the highest point in South Carolina. It's a popular destination for hikers and outdoor enthusiasts who come to enjoy the panoramic views and natural beauty of the area.
